Centre extends tax exemption benefits to IREDA bonds

New Delhi, July 10: The Central Board of Direct Taxes (CBDT) has notified bonds issued by Indian Renewable Energy Development Agency Ltd. (IREDA) as "long-term specified assets" that are eligible for tax exemption benefits under section 54EC of the Income-tax Act.

Govt approves 187 startups for tax exemption to boost growth

New Delhi, May 15: In a significant boost to India's startup ecosystem, the Department for Promotion of Industry and Internal Trade (DPIIT) has approved 187 startups for income tax exemption under the revamped Section 80-IAC of the Income Tax Act, according to an official statement issued on Thursday.

One crore people will benefit from revised slabs, pay no tax: FM Sitharaman

New Delhi, Feb 1: Union Finance Minister Nirmala Sitharaman, in her first post-Budget press conference, said that the revision in tax slabs as announced in the Union Budget 2025-26 will leave 'enough money in the hands' of taxpayers, adding that about 1 crore taxpayers will be directly benefitted from the extended rebates and exemptions, under the New Tax regime.
